About Yellow Pepper Plant

The Yellow Pepper Plant, scientifically known as Capsicum annuum, is a versatile addition to any indoor garden. With its ability to produce vibrant yellow peppers (completely ornamental), it adds both aesthetic and culinary value to your space. This compact Capsicum variety boasts lush green foliage and, with proper care, can reach a maximum height of around 90 centimeters. It thrives in well-lit areas, making it an excellent choice for sunny windowsills or balconies with ample sunlight. While the Yellow Pepper Plant is not known to be toxic to pets or babies, it's always wise to place indoor plants out of reach of curious little hands or paws.

Growing your Yellow Pepper Plant is a rewarding decorative choice as the eye-catching peppers begin to appear. Keep the soil consistently moist, allowing it to dry slightly between waterings to support healthy growth. The Yellow Pepper Plant brings a touch of the garden into your home.
